Output d89c8c58dc3654f150935911d5e8501cfc79dcb689f35355f00aef3dd286ba4e:0

value
997656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b4299812741d2323f8cd893b8d4bc30c8f39ca OP_EQUAL
address
3NMiTogqah7yxzUmFqn1QmFNcPjmJpmk8L
transaction
d89c8c58dc3654f150935911d5e8501cfc79dcb689f35355f00aef3dd286ba4e
confirmations
317991
spent
true